Life Teen Summer Camp Auckland 2022

Cancellation Announcement

LIFE TEEN SUMMER CAMP AUCKLAND 2022

CANCELLATION ANNOUNCEMENT

 

Kia ora koutou everyone,

Thank you so much for your continued enthusiasm around Life Teen Summer Camp Auckland 2022. The team has been blown away by your support for this event, especially in the midst of ongoing uncertainty surrounding COVID-19.

Unfortunately, due to ongoing COVID restrictions, we’ve had to make the difficult decision to cancel Life Teen Summer Camp 2022.

As we’re sure you are aware, New Zealand is currently under Red traffic light restrictions as part of the COVID protection framework. What this means is that events are limited to a maximum of 100 participants.

Hopefully COVID cases will be declining by the end of March, but there is no certainty about whether restrictions will reduce before Summer Camp is due to begin in April. It is primarily for this reason that we’ve had to make the decision to cancel Life Teen Summer camp.

That’s the bad news.

The good news is that we will be replacing Summer Camp with two new events, which will be able to go ahead even if we are still under Red traffic light restrictions in April.

The first of these events is Rise Up, a youth camp taking place from Wednesday 20 April – Friday 22 April. Rise Up is going to be an awesome 3 days of fun, friends and faith for the teens of our Diocese. This event is for 13-18yr olds and their youth leaders. Registrations will be opening on Monday 28 February and will be limited to 100 participants, so get in quickly.

The second event is Summit, a weekend for our Youth and Young Adults leaders. This will be taking place from the evening of Friday 22 April until Sunday 24 April. COVID means that the Auckland Catholic Youth Ministry team can’t the large-scale events that we normally would. But we are so grateful that our youth and young adults leaders are still able to do great ministry at a local level.

With this in mind, we really want to invest into the young leaders of the Diocese over the coming months. If you’re a leader, then Summit is for you. In the Bible there are so many stories of leaders ascending to the summit to go deeper with God, and get formed and filled up for ministry. That is our intention with this weekend. Again, registrations open on Monday 28 February and we’re limited to 100 participants. Leaders, you do not want to miss this event.

 Finally, we want you to know that Life Teen Summer Camp 2023 is already locked in for next January.

 While we are sad to cancel Life Teen Summer Camp 2022, we are still excited for April and we are excited to be able to move ahead with greater certainty.

 For everyone who is able to be a part of Rise Up or Summit, any registration costs that you’ve already paid can go straight towards your registration for these new events. However, for anyone who needs it, we will be offering a full refund of the registration costs paid. We will be contacting every group that has registered in the coming days with further information about this.

I want to finish by saying a few massive thank yous. Thank you to staff and the planning team. Thank you also to our summer missionaries and volunteers. There has been so much hard work put into Life Teen Summer Camp, and fortunately a lot of that work can now be transferred over to our new events. It isn’t going to waste.

Thank you once again to everyone who had been part of the Life Teen Summer Camp journey. We’re still looking forward to April, and in spite of COVID, we are looking forward to what I’m sure will be an incredible year where the Holy Spirit is moving in the Young People of the Diocese.

FOR TEENS AGED 13 - 17

Life Teen is a movement within the Roman Catholic Church, which leads teenagers and their families into a deeper relationship with Jesus Christ and His Church.  Life Teen Summer Camp is aimed for teens aged 13-17.   One of the big focuses at Life Teen is parish-based discipleship. Life Teen want campers to attend and grow in their faith, as well as grow closer with their parish family.  The Life Teen Summer Camps Leadership Team plans, prepares, and facilitates the programming, liturgies and activities for each day. Each day teens will experience Mass and other powerful prayer experiences. Key sessions, led by a dynamic speaker, will break open scriptural topics to lead your teens into a more authentic encounter with Christ. Once during the week the Sacrament of Reconciliation will be available. All of this alongside an obstacle course, messy games, plenty of free time and much more. Each day campers will enjoy three delicious meals.

SUMMER MISSIONS FOR THOSE 18 AND OVER

For young adults who would like to serve they can join Life Teen’s Summer Missions programme.  This provides young adults with the opportunity to serve at a Life Teen summer camp. Young adults can serve in a variety of roles, all with the focus of providing a safe, welcoming, exciting environment for teens to have an incredible summer camp experience while growing in their faith.  No matter the gifts and talents of the young adult Life Teen can be a transformational experience where they not only lead teens closer to Christ but their own relationship with Christ becomes stronger.

Summer Staff:

Summer Staff serve primarily as a relational ministers who are trained in the facilitation of small group discussions and team-building activities.

Summer Staff Ministry Description

Service Crew:

The service crew includes an amazing group of young adults that serves primarily behind the scenes as the backbone of summer camp. Through a number of different roles, summer missionaries on service crew are responsible for keeping camp running efficiently.  

Hospitality Ministry Role Description

Facilities Team Ministry Description

Logistics:

Those serving on the logistics team will assist in the smooth running of camp primarily by helping in areas of liturgy, sessions happening in the main hall and all outdoor activities.
